What Is IFSC Code and Why Is It Important?
IFSC stands for Indian Financial System Code, which is an 11-character alphanumeric code provided by the Reserve Bank of India. Format of the IFSC Code HDFC0CECB07
The format of the IFSC Code for banks, including Hdfc Bank, follows an 11-character structure:
AAAA0CCCCCC
Here's the breakdown:
- First 4 characters (AAAA): These represent the bank code. In Hdfc Bank, they are a short identifier for the bank.
- 5th character (0): This is always zero and is reserved for future use.
- Last 6 characters (CCCCCC): These are what represent the specific branch code which is assigned to branches like Eastern Railway Employees Coop Bank Ltd in Burdwan.

NEFT
Add the beneficiary's name, account number, and IFSC Code HDFC0CECB07. The transfer is completed in batches instead of instantly. It is useful for both personal and business payments.
RTGS
Used for high-value payments above ₹2 lakh. Real-time settlement using the IFSC Code of the recipient branch.
IMPS
Instant 24×7 transfers. Requires the recipient's account details and Hdfc Bank IFSC Code HDFC0CECB07.
